Output 408cdf5d21c1d684c4f7e1363d6ee54897fc5bfabd423f167f94413fcb7761ab:1

value
1527775000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d940403234c4ff997945f4a8110bed321aad40c OP_EQUAL
address
3EbcWuDXGzyRxFEwDqQWgPtg6DvbaGb6G2
transaction
408cdf5d21c1d684c4f7e1363d6ee54897fc5bfabd423f167f94413fcb7761ab
spent
true